Epoxy flooring in a rice parish that waited 300 years to incorporate
Goose Creek was settled in 1670 by Barbadian planters like Sir John Yeamans, becoming home to the politically powerful Goose Creek Men faction and a major rice-producing parish, though the city itself wasn't established until 1961. Few cities anywhere waited three centuries between settlement and actual incorporation.
